The following code corrects button bounce and is very similar to the code example that is provided within MPIDE examples (File→Example→Digital→ Debounce). This code is extended to provide a button press counter capability (by counting rising edges) to verify the code is operating correctly.
WebRazer's marketing about debounce adding delay is not false. The current method of denouncing switches just relies on having a delay longer than the switch could bounce for, for some mice that is 20ms or more, standard "good" debounce delay is 4ms.
